I ordered the flexable model with my '03 Baja. Stupid decision because
I actually use the Baja to take about 20 bags of pine needles to the dump
each fall. I wasn't able to get the flexable model off (inept?) and had
to have the dealer remove it. It looks good, but if you only fold it back
there's only access to about half the bed unless things are below the bed
sides. That doesn't cut it when I get up to 8 each 50 gallon trash bags
in the bed. I believe the cost was $300! ;-(

I have the flexible one, by choice I might add. The hard covers are nice
and provide more security but you are also limited in carrying tall loads.
The flexi job allows me to get the benefits of weather protection for the
groceries and, I guess, better mileage. The fixed portion actually only
extends about a foot from the rear window and hasn't been a problem so far.
For bigger loads I got the bed extender and with the tailgate lowered this
has been OK
